Taxon: Liatris ligulistylis (A. Nelson) K. Schumann
Family: Asteraceae
Collector: Smith, Welby   7458   
Date: 1982-08-20
Locality: United States, Minnesota, Mower, Racine Prairie Scientific Natural Area. Racine Prairie State Scientific and Natural Area. Adjacent to the E side of U.S. Trunk Hwy.63, about 2 mi N of Racine. N Racine Prairie State Scientific and Natural Area. Adjacent to the E side of U.S. Trunk Hwy.63, about 2 mi N of Racine. NE1/4 NE1/4 sec.22, T104N R14W. 104N 14W 22
43.797643  -92.499267 +-800m.  WGS84
Habitat: Mesic prairie strip. With Liatris pycnostachya, Helenium autumnale, Prenanthes racemosa, Desmodium canadense.
